9:00 AM-11:00 AM Retirement Countdown
, Tamla Cole, STRS presenter. If you’re 12-18 months from retirement and ready for the “nuts and bolts” of the retirement process, don’t miss this session.
Learn about completing the online Service Retirement Application, plan of payment options, designation of single or multiple beneficiaries and enrollment in the STRS Ohio Health Care Program. Additionally, we will provide an overview of what to expect during the retirement process and address any questions you may have during the presentation. All participants receive a retirement booklet that highlights the key steps in the retirement process month-by-month.
